Developments of the K-Algorithm in the Computation of the HSI Noise from Rotors and propellers

Sandro IANNIELLO
2000

Abstract

This paper describes the developments and improvements of the K-Algorithm, a numerical procedure developed to model the retarded configuration of a supersonic rotating surface. The algorithm has been recently reviwed in order to reduce the requested CPU time and to treat some advanced (rotor and propeller) configurations. The effectiveness and robustness of the new procedure will be tested by examining four different configurations and determining the time evolution of the corresponding acoustic domain.
